Men of our parish, welcome! We are not meant to walk this road alone. As Christian men, we are pilgrims—called to journey together in faith, to learn, to grow, and to be transformed. That is the heart of our new men’s ministry: The Society of St. Timothy.

Nearly every week, our clergy hear from a downtrodden parent: “Father, my child no longer practices the faith.” Why have so many children in younger generations drifted far from faith? While admittedly a complex combination of factors has contributed to a loss of faith among younger generations, myriad studies have consistently indicated one key that helps to mitigate this loss: when a father boldly lives out his Catholic faith, 3 out of every 4 children will continue practicing the faith after leaving home. This fall, our parish will offer an opportunity (complementing our existing men’s ministries) for men of all ages to grow in faith and fellowship: the Society of St. Timothy will foster a community of men seeking to encourage one another to strive for greater holiness in their communities (and especially among their families). The Society will meet on Tuesday mornings from 6:00 – 7:15 a.m. in the Parish Hall and follow Paradisus Dei’s That Man Is You program.
